Interloop Partners With Oxford Pakistan Program
Interloop Limited has announced a new graduate scholarship for Pakistani students. The initiative is launched in collaboration with the Oxford Pakistan Programme at the University of Oxford.
The scholarship is titled the Interloop Oxford Graduate Scholarship. It aims to support talented Pakistani students pursuing higher education at Oxford.
Under the program, one Pakistani student will be selected each year. The award will go to a candidate who secures admission to a full-time graduate program at Oxford.
Interloop Limited will cover 60 percent of the total cost. The remaining 40 percent will be arranged through philanthropic contributions under the Oxford Pakistan Programme.
The scholarship will fund tuition fees and living expenses. It will apply to Masterโs and DPhil programs. Funding will continue for the full duration of the selected course.

Scholarship Covers Tuition and Living Expenses
The Interloop Oxford Graduate Scholarship is open to Pakistani nationals only. Applicants must first gain admission to a full-time graduate course at Oxford.
The funding package includes complete tuition support. It also covers living costs in the UK. This reduces the financial burden on families.
Oxford remains one of the most competitive universities globally. High tuition and living expenses often prevent talented students from applying. This scholarship aims to remove that barrier.
All eligible candidates can apply regardless of gender. However, preference will be given to female students. Priority will also be given to applicants from underprivileged backgrounds.

Applications will follow Oxfordโs graduate admissions schedule. Interested students must secure admission before being considered for funding.
